Address

RuA5pPZPux3Dg92GaKrTRSKc1VV7RwDTqU

0 RDD

Confirmed
Total Received438123.00000000 RDD22.96 USD
Total Sent438123.00000000 RDD22.96 USD
Final Balance0 RDD0.00 USD
No. Transactions2

Transactions

RuA5pPZPux3Dg92GaKrTRSKc1VV7RwDTqU438123.00000000 RDD22.96 USD22.96 USD
 
RoSj2eLSfQ3aRRPQ7gu6EQxe5GuYykTtBd438066.00000000 RDD22.96 USD22.96 USD
Roae4d8odRMtupZ6ZBTPX3kFWxH8U5sg6257.00000000 RDD0.00 USD0.00 USD
RbfKHp7S446wjkfGYE5U6hoo59Cf1a7xb3438180.00000000 RDD22.97 USD22.97 USD
 
RuA5pPZPux3Dg92GaKrTRSKc1VV7RwDTqU438123.00000000 RDD22.96 USD22.96 USD
RcWUNyeDEf4YBt6GXyXivCdAYfUaimnt2T57.00000000 RDD0.00 USD0.00 USD